OVERVIEW

The Print Shop Specialist is responsible for operating printing equipment, managing stock & inventory, providing customer service to both internal & external stakeholders, ensuring quality control of printed materials, maintaining all shop equipment, and performing basic administrative tasks while adhering to established print specifications and deadlines.

MAJOR RESPONSIBILITIES

Process & sort mail in compliance with US Postal Service requirements for bulk mail Print documentation & enter information into Postal Wizard for submission to post office Fold, bind, staple, or insert printed materials into envelopes based on client specifications Prepare supplies & materials for shipment, including international mailing Process documentation required for customs declarations & carnets Maintain work space: Clean and wipe down work area, organize supply inventory & replenish as needed Assist with processing checks and operating postage machine Operate a variety of printing equipment including copiers, printers, laminators, and binding machines. Load paper, adjust print settings, and monitor print quality. Perform basic finishing tasks like cutting, folding, and stapling Log print jobs, including customer details, print specifications, and pricing. Generate invoices and collect payments. Maintain print job records and reports. Perform other assignments in the mailroom as needed

FOCUSED RESPONSIBILITIES

Set up, print, & process gift receipts & other materials/documentation as needed for internal & external stakeholders Follow instructions regarding format of final documentation Process mailing lists, update system software accordingly, and communicate all changes to list owners. Inspect printed materials for accuracy, color consistency, and quality issues. Identify and report any printing errors to the supervisor. Perform routine cleaning and maintenance on printing equipment. Report any equipment malfunctions to the appropriate person Maintain stock levels of paper, toner cartridges, and other printing supplies. Track inventory levels and place orders when necessary. Organize and store printing materials properly. Step in for the Logistics Specialist if needed
